WebbSimplify the following expression: \mathbf {\color {green} { \left (\dfrac {3} {\mathit {x}}\right)^ {-2} }} (x3)−2. This is a special case. The negative exponent says that whatever is on top should go underneath, and whatever is underneath should go on top. So I'll just flip the fraction (remembering to change the power from a negative to a ... WebbVideo Transcript.
